Whether that is true or not, how do people deal with the bugs shooting at their face on the rides, especially around dusk? The CP sandflies, Mayflies or Muffleheads are an Ohio treasure! Eat up and enjoy! They are a part of the CP experience, for better or worse. I can't tell you how many times I had one smash in an eye on rides at night. They'd find ways into your underwear and between your toes if you went in sandals. Open your mouth on a coaster at night? A still buzzing Mufflehead would crash into the back of your throat. When I worked at the park in the early 90s (Blue Streak manual operation with 1,250 riders per hour!) I got to know those flies well. They were everywhere. The Dodgem had these giant plastic letter boxes D-O-D-G-E-M that were backlit; they will fill about 1/3 of the way with dead Muffleheads. They'd have to remove the letters and dump the bugs. The Cedars dorms had these old-fashioned breezeways between buildings and people were afraid to go through them as they were crawling with giant spiders. Crews would spray them all out every couple weeks just to try to cut down on the spiders. They were so big you could see your reflection in all their eyes. We used to joke they were monster size due to all the Muffleheads available to feast on. When Magnum was being planned, they drew special attention to the windshields being designed into the trains to help keep those bugs out of people's faces. It helps - a little - and now we have those awesome and strange retro/future funky train fronts. The park was selling shirts with a huge cartoon Mufflehead one year. Can't find any pictures of that.
